Thursday, May 22, 2008 Sheryl Crow: A Cause Close to the Heart
Speaking on a matter close to the heart, Sheryl Crow testified in front of a congressional hearing at the Rayburn Building in Washington DC on Wednesday (May 21). The 46-year-old breast cancer surviving rocker was there to discuss the Breast Cancer and Environmental Research Act, which she’s been more than willing to help out with. “I want to know what causes this disease – for me, and for the 2.3 million others who share this diagnosis,” said Crow as she spoke on behalf of the National Breast Cancer Coalition. “We need more resources to figure out what the environment has to do with [it].” And while many fall victim to this deadly disease, Crow told People magazine that she’s doing quite well since her 2006 diagnosis. “I’m great, as far as I know.
